Van Halen’s 2004 concerts in Tucson elevated AVA Amphitheater . Unmute. Play. That event took place on the stage at Casino del Sol’s Ava Amphitheater here in Tucson. With comfortable seating for almost 5,000 attendees, Casino Del Sol’s AVA Amphitheater is the premier concert venue in Tucson. This beautiful, open-air venue offers a truly unique concert-going experience.
